Out-of-Pocket Expenses and Payment Plans
While you may expect insurance policy coverage, a lot of LASIK procedures require out-of-pocket expenses. The ordinary expense of LASIK can vary from $2,000 to $3,000 per eye, depending upon different variables like the technology made use of and your specialist's expertise. Lots of centers offer payment plans to aid you take care of these costs. You can often break down the total right into month-to-month settlements, that makes it extra manageable. Some companies may also enable you to use health and wellness savings accounts (HSAs) or adaptable spending accounts (FSAs) to cover expenses. Be sure to inquire about any kind of funding choices during your appointment, as discovering a plan that fits your budget can make the decision to undergo LASIK much easier.
Alternate Funding Alternatives for LASIK Surgical Treatment
If you're thinking about LASIK but are worried concerning the upfront costs, there are numerous alternate financing alternatives that can aid make the procedure more budget-friendly. Lots of LASIK facilities provide internal funding plans, enabling you to pay in convenient monthly installments rather than one lump sum. In addition, you could discover medical bank card that supply interest-free promotional durations, providing you versatility in settlement. Some health care lenders focus on vision procedures, supplying individual car loans particularly for LASIK. You might additionally get in touch with your company; some business use health savings accounts or flexible spending accounts, which can cover LASIK prices with pre-tax bucks.
